Rabbit流密码的Java实现

1. Rabbit流密码(Rabbit Stream Cipher)简介

Rabbit流密码是由Cryptico公司(http://www.cryptico.com)设计的,密钥长度128位,

最大加密消息长度为264 Bytes,即16 TB,若消息超过该长度,则需要更换密钥对剩下的消息进行处理。它是目前安全性较高,加/解密速度比较高效的流密码之一,在各种处理器平台上都有不凡的表现。

详细资料:

1.http://www.cryptico.com/Files/filer/rabbit_fse.pdf

2.http://www.ietf.org/rfc/rfc4503.txt

本文实现了该算法的java语言实现,仅供参考。

Rabbit流密码的C/C++实现请参考我的加密算法库CryptoFBC: code.google.com/p/cryptofbc

2. 实现源码

用最少的悔恨面对过去

Rabbit流密码的Java实现

相关文章:

你感兴趣的文章:

标签云: